What your child will build
We focus on practical early skills that support school admission, classroom confidence, and everyday independence.
Advanced Phonics
We support A-Z letter recognition, sound awareness, simple blends, and early reading foundations.
Early Reading Skills
Your child begins to connect sounds, letters, words, stories, and meaning in a gentle, age-appropriate way.
Numbers 0-50
We introduce counting, ordering, number recognition, and early arithmetic using hands-on tools and activities.
Early Writing
We support name writing, lowercase alphabets, number formation, pencil control, and fine motor development.
Social Skills
Your child learns to participate, interact, listen, take turns, and build confidence around other children.
Independence & Confidence
We encourage simple routines, emotional regulation, focus, self-expression, and confidence in learning.

A week inside Kinder Bridge
Each week is built around engaging themes, so your child explores different areas of development in a natural and enjoyable way.
Communication
Stories, videos, discussions, listening, and speaking activities.
Literacy
Beginning sounds, letters, worksheets, games, and early reading practice.
Numeracy
Counting, ordering, sorting, patterns, and early number formation.
Creative Learning
Simple crafts and expressive activities linked to the weekly theme.
Social Confidence
Show-and-tell, role play, confidence-building, and peer interaction.
Learning feels meaningful when it connects to real life
We use familiar, child-friendly themes such as family, community helpers, seasons, shapes, celebrations, and the world around us. These themes help your child connect new ideas to everyday life while building school readiness skills.
